Dead Man's Shoes
Originally released in 1940. Dead Man's Shoes is a crime/drama film. directed by Thomas Bentley. At just 70 minutes, it's a tight, focused story.
Starring Leslie Banks, Joan Marion, and Geoffrey Atkins
Synopsis
An amnesia victim is a well liked and respected member of his community--until one day someone from his past shows up with evidence that in "the old days" he had been a notorious criminal, and threatens to expose him unless he pays off.
